Can Men Watch Reality TV in Peace?



A slew of reality shows appear on our television every day, and a lot of them cater to a woman’s incessant need to watch drama. We’ve gotBasketball WivesLove & Hip-HopBad Girls ClubReal Housewives of AtlantaJersey ShoreTeen Mom and a list of other shows that focus on love, sex, relationships, etcetera. My problem? Men, quote unquote, cannot tune into this shows without running the risk of having their manhood called into question. I chuckle at the notion. I mean, sure we’d rather a man tweet about a game of sports than Snooki’s latest drunken smush, but whatever floats your boat is cool with me. There are four male perspectives on the Jersey Shore that our men can identify with.
There’s definitely some shows that men and women can watch together, i.e., Love & Hip-Hop. Several scenarios in the storyline relate to how a man thinks, how he acts and what he says to his woman, especially with Emily B and Chrissy. Basketball Wives, on the other hand, has plenty of beautiful women that a man can, at the very least, gawk at. I’ve watch guys across my timeline get a kick out of watching the way they don’t want their women to conduct themselves in public, and it doesn’t seem like they’re being “less of a man” at all. On the contrary, it sparks some pretty good debates.
Of course, there are questionable TV spots, like Teen Mom and Bad Girls Club, that I feel a guy just might not be able to get into. You may question why he’s not watching basketball instead on that one, but I challenge us to be a bit more open-minded, ladies. I know plenty of guys who just like to stay in-the-know on television or can simply root for the males on these women-centric shows.

Think Like A Man’ Sequel?



The first silver screen adaptation of Steve Harvey‘s book isn’t out yet, but Sony Pictures has already given the word on a sequel. Hours ago, Will Packer of Rainforest Films tweeted:
“Pres of Sony/Screen Gems just announced a sequel to @ThinkLikeAMan on @IAmSteveHarvey!!!!!”
Could it be? We haven’t even seen if the first one is any good yet. However, the trailer does indicate some funny, ‘Yes, girl!’ moments to come. Starring film faves Gabrielle UnionMeagan GoodTaraji P. HensonMichael Ealy, Regina Hall and comedian Kevin Hart, this movie may already have winning box office numbers in the bag.

Kardashian’s Launch Denim Line



The Kardashian’s have launched a new Kollection of jeans specifically designed to meet women’s individual figures. Kim took to Twitter last night to announce the new Sears denim line which features three styles named after each sister. She tweeted:

“I’m wearing The Kim, which is a sexy, low cut, straight leg jean. Then Kourtney is wearing The Kourtney, a gorgeous skinny leg jean, and Khloe is wearing The Khloe, a tall curvy, high rise, boot cut!! The jeans come in different washes so you can choose the fit and wash that’s perfect for you!”
Sounds like the sisters have their bases covered. We’ll have to see how the denim adds to their other lines of swimwear, clothing, and accessories.

Gayle King Shuts Down Rumors, Confirms That Oprah Is NOT Blue Ivy Carter’s Godmother


For those of you running around thinking Oprah is the godmommy of Baby Blue Ivy Carter, Gayle King says helllll to the nawl:
“It’s absolutely not true that she’s the godmother. She’s friends with them, of course, and likes them both very much. She’s working on sending them a baby gift. She hasn’t even had time to send a baby gift because she’s been away.”Then Gayle pulls away from her staunch stance stating, “Let me just say, if (that report is) true, it is news to her. It is news to her. You know, she was heading to South Africa when the baby was born.
Well there you have it.
